    My daily driver. 4000 plus miles.
    I have been quite satisfied with my attempt. Incremental improvements over the past year. Latest is a kickstand that allows me to change a tire, adjust brakes, shifter, or tighten spokes, load cargo, prevent it form falling over in the wind.
    20 to 30 miles a day from solar. No pedaling.
    second trailered panel allows 50 to 75 miles per day. Trailer functional, but needs improvement.

      Can you list all the components that you used? I have seen solar systems with and without batteries. The battery-less systems are very low powered and provide no assist in the dark. Very light, though.

        13.5 luna pf cell 52v battery
        100 watt renogy flex panel
        Genentech gvb 8 wp controler 58.4 lithium
        mounted on aluminum custom fairing for protection fro crash etc.
        Rans nimbus recumbent
        750 watt bafang mid drive.
        changed rear wheel to 27.5 with schwalbe. E bike tire
        Other........
        Consistently gives 25 miles per day at over 20 mph. 32 mph top speed. Auxillary batteries.
        160 watt renogy panel on trailer. Over 60 miles per day by solar. Leaving woth fully charged batteries 150 miles per day. No pedaling.
        over 1 year. Needed a chain. Several crashes no damage. Most neccesary is protection for panel physical damage. Daily driver. Over 5k miles of testing and improvements.

              #7
              Not only fragile, but highly susceptible to side winds. I would not even try a canopy on a two wheeler. Tendency to change lanes without notice is not a good thing. That is problem i had with current trailer.
              Bob trailer coming next week. It is nice having over 2.5 amp charge rate. The 1 to 1.4 with 100 amp panel is nice for shorter and daily use. My 11.5 ah battery acts like a 17.5 ah around town. Never plug in. Integrates nicely. Peoole love it. No end to picture taki g and people shouting out encouragement.
              But for serious touring, 300 watt. Never get that without a trailer. That much area of panel has been a bad reaction for its assault on convention.
              if i were to start over, i think i would start with a bakfiet style bike.
